420 with CNW – Bipartisan Lawmakers Urge DEA to Allow Researchers to Study Cannabis from Dispensaries

On Friday, a bipartisan coalition of legislators from the House and Senate sent a letter to the Department of Justice requesting policy amendments, which would allow researchers to use marijuana bought from state-legal dispensaries for their studies on its benefits and risks.

The legislators were led by Rep. Harley Rouda (D-CA) and Sen. Brian Schatz (D-HI). In the letter, they cited federal health agencies’ feedback where they said that research on marijuana is inhibited by the existing restrictions on cannabis. The primary challenge is that there exists only one federally-authorized facility producing research-grade marijuana.

Although the DEA said that they are in the process of authorizing more manufacturers, three years have passed since they announced approving more research-grade marijuana growers. The same agency further noted that it is in the process of developing alternative rules for licensing submitted applications.

However, the National Institute of Health and the Food and Drug Administration released a status quo report that did not address the barriers inhibiting researchers from using marijuana obtained from dispensaries for their research. The letter recommends for the agencies to allow researchers to use marijuana acquired from the state-legal dispensaries.

The legislators wrote in their letter that many states have marijuana laws and regulations in place for licensing industrial manufacturing activities and products for medical marijuana but not for research purposes, which would lead to FDA licensure.

The letter also repeatedly pointed out the lack of chemical diversity of the marijuana supplied by the federal government. One study found that marijuana obtained from a national research facility is more similar to hemp than to cannabis found in the market.

The bipartisan coalition made two recommendations; the first one is the amendment of internal policy which would allow researchers with Schedule 1 licenses to obtain marijuana-derived products from state-legal dispensaries for study. The second one is to issue guidance clarifying that DEA licenses are not a must for hemp researchers and that they can obtain hemp since it was legalized under the 2018 Farm Bill across the U.S.

The DEA is required to issue a response to the letter by December 20.

Twenty-one members of Congress signed the letter, including Senators such as Kamala Harris (D-CA), Cory Gardner (R-CO), Earl Blumenauer (D-OR), Joe Kennedy (D-MA), and Matt Gaetz (R-FL).

In a press release, Rouda said that the U.S. research laws are ancient. He also noted that 47 states have some form of marijuana legalization, and the federal agencies must ensure that there is a way to study the benefits and risks of marijuana products.

In April, Attorney General William Barr received a similar letter requesting for an increase in the number of federally-approved cannabis cultivators.

420 with CNW – Trimming Technology to Boost the Cannabis Industry

Companies operating in the cannabis industry are in existence because of the marijuana plant, which is cultivated and harvested to manufacture marijuana products and services. The marijuana plant is harvested through trimming, a process through which the farmer separates the stem and leaves from the flower. When trimming is done correctly, the marijuana plant dries properly and the buds are highly potent and appealing to customers when taken to the market. When there are many plants to be harvested, trimming can be quite tiresome and time-consuming.

Innovators in the cannabis industry are working on developing a faster process of trimming through the use of technology, and the first discovery will garner a lot of profits since farmers are looking for a way they can harvest faster.

Hand Trimming is Rudimentary But Popular

The most popular method of trimming marijuana during the harvesting season is hand trimming, which has been in use for several years now. However, the technique is rudimentary and time-consuming.

The only technological improvement that has been made on the hand trimming equipment is the design of the scissor blade. The design enables the blade to cut through the marijuana plant easily.

The scissor blade is fitted with springs to reduce the amount of effort used when cutting, and the curve blade was adapted to enable the blade to cut into tight spaces.

Despite the improvement in the blade design, the hand trimming process is still rudimentary and time-consuming even though it is the most used method of harvesting across the globe.

Trimming Machine Technology

In the past few decades, there has been a wave of new cutting machines in the marijuana sector. The trimming process is made faster by the device since one machine does the work of several workers in a hand trimmer.

However, the downside to the machines is that they may result in a significant loss of trichomes. Another disadvantage is that many leaves may be left on the bud since the trimming mechanism is not as precise as a hand trimmer.

When trimming buds from the larger branches, trimming machine technology is very efficient, but it requires the intervention of a hand trimmer to cut the water leaves from the buds with the use of trimming scissors.

The Soft Tissues of the Marijuana Plants Make it Difficult to Trim

The marijuana plant is comprised of soft tissues, especially the buds, which are the essential parts of the plant, and this makes it challenging to use harvesting machines.

Harvesting should be done with caution to avoid dislodging trichomes, which are very delicate, from the marijuana flower.

The technology used in harvesting other crops cannot be incorporated in the marijuana sector because of the delicate nature of the marijuana plant.

Compared to other crops, marijuana plant growth is not uniform as some are tall and others short and bushy; thus, machines used for other crops cannot be used for cannabis plants. And this makes the process of designing a trimming machine for marijuana crops a little challenging.

420 with CNW – Huge Demand Forces Michigan Recreational Weed Retailers to Impose Purchase Limits

In Michigan, recreational marijuana business is booming. On Wednesday, a recorded message from Arbors Wellness in Ann Arbor said that currently, the shop has a high number of customers, which is keeping them extra busy and they are therefore unable to answer calls. The overwhelming demand has even led to purchase limits being imposed by the retailers.

The sale of recreational marijuana in Michigan was launched on December 1 and since then, demand has been so high that businesses were forced to turn away customers at some point. On the first day of recreational sales, four shops generated an average of $221,000.

On Wednesday, Arbor Wellness owner, James Daly, said that they had a line of customers all day and that they are working through the lines professionally with a wait time of approximately 40 minutes.

Greenstone Provisions in Ann Arbor employees said that by 1 pm on Wednesday, the wait time to get served was about 2-hours. While on Tuesday, customers had to wait for 3 to 4-hours before getting served at Exclusive Brand’s dispensary in Ann Arbor.

Michigan Supply and Provisions in Morenci, located along the border with Ohio, is having a steady flow of customers; however, on Wednesday afternoon, no customers were waiting in line to be served.

On Sunday and Monday, Greenstone Provisions had to turn away hundreds of potential customers because it had run out of stock of marijuana buds. Since then, the retail outlets made a point of restocking daily.

Marijuana shops have been forced to institute a purchase cap on the amount of marijuana each individual is supposed to buy because of the massive demand. Greenstone Provisions, Michigan Supply, and Provisions in Morenci have instituted a sale limit of 7 grams of marijuana flower per person.

Arbor Wellness’ sale limit is 1/8 of an ounce of flower. They also have a purchase limit of two edibles, seven pre-rolled joints, and 15 vaping cartridges.

The only dispensary that did not institute purchasing caps is Exclusive Brands. On Wednesday, Omar Hishmesh, Exclusive Brands co-owner, said that they are not putting any sale limit since they are not going to run out of stock. He further noted that they are fully stocked and are actively re-stocking products; thus, no shortages.

According to Michigan laws, the sale limit for the flower is 2.5 ounces, which includes a maximum of 15 grams of concentrate.

In-store inventory is moving like a hotcake, which makes real-time resupplying difficult; however, business owners still insist product shortages will not happen any time soon.

Currently, there are three licensed recreational marijuana processing plants and one licensed transportation business in Michigan.

Greenstone Provisions and Michigan Supply and Provisions inventory is at the mercy of their competition since the three licensed processing facilities are owned by their competitors. The three facilities are owned by Exclusive Brands, Arbor Wellness, and Green Peak. Green Peak is the largest processing facility in Michigan, and it is planning on establishing retail locations across the state.

420 with CNW – Michael Bloomberg Now Supports Marijuana Decriminalization

Former New York Mayor Michael Bloomberg is a Democratic presidential candidate who has been outspoken against marijuana law reforms but is now in favor of decriminalizing marijuana possession.

On November 24, Bloomberg launched a late bid for the Democratic presidential nomination; however, he faced criticism for making dismissive remarks earlier in the year about cannabis legalization when he said that the policy change is the stupidest thing anybody has ever done.

On Wednesday, the Wall Street Journal reported that Bloomberg is in support of criminal justice reform for the decriminalization of simple marijuana possession and states’ right to end prohibition without intervention from the federal authorities. This shows that he is trying to distance himself from the anti-marijuana image he previously had.

Speaking to the Wall Street Journal, Bloomberg said that no one’s life should be ruined through incarceration for marijuana possession. He also noted that his reform efforts reduced imprisonment by 40% and that he worked hard to get New York laws changed to stop simple possession arrests. Bloomberg further said that he believes in decriminalization and that the states which have legalized marijuana should not be subjected to federal interference.

In 2011, Bloomberg vetoed a New York bill whose purpose was to treat simple marijuana possession with a court summons and fine instead of incarceration; however, two years later, he supported the legislation seeking to reduce criminal punishments for low-level cannabis possession. Bloomberg also called for alterations in the way law enforcement handle such cases.

The majority of the Democratic presidential candidates would be several steps ahead of Bloomberg even after he incorporates the proposal for decriminalizing marijuana possession in his policies because almost all Democratic candidates are in favor of comprehensive marijuana legalization and removal of cannabis from Schedule 1 of the Controlled Substances Act. This change would ensure that the legal marijuana industry is socially equitable.

Former Vice President, Joe Biden, is another presidential candidate who is against marijuana legalization. However, he has voiced his support for decriminalization, medical cannabis legalization, and modest federal rescheduling. But, he has vetoed legalization of adult-use marijuana.

Both Biden and Bloomberg made some negative remarks on marijuana reforms that received criticism. Earlier this year, Biden said that he does not support broad marijuana reforms as it could act as a gateway to harmful drugs. Bloomberg also noted that legalization is perhaps the stupidest thing ever done and that it doe not make any sense.

Although both candidates are now in support of decriminalization, other candidates such as Pete Buttigieg and Tulsi Gabbard are supporting the decriminalization of all drugs, while Julian Castro is considering broad marijuana reform.
